Azimuthal Anisotropy in U+U Collisions at sNN = 193 GeV with STAR Detector at RHIC
Abstract
We report the measurement of first ( n = 1) and higher order(n = 2-5) harmonic coefficients (vn) of the azimuthal anisotropy in the distribution of the particles produced in U+U collisions at sNN =193 GeV, recorded with the STAR detector at RHIC. The differential measurement of (vn) is presented as a function of transverse momentum (pT) and centrality. We also present vn measurement in the ultra-central collisions. These data may provide strong constraints on the theoretical models of the initial condition in heavy ion collisions and the transport properties of the produced medium.
